Marc Dorcel has played a significant role in mainstreaming high-quality erotic content in Europe, often leading discussions on the democratization of adult media.

In France and across Europe, "Dorcel" became a household name, frequently referenced in mainstream talk shows, comedies, and cultural commentaries. The brand successfully detached itself from the typical stigma of the industry, standing instead as a symbol of French eroticism, luxury, and entrepreneurial success. Founded in 1979 by French entrepreneur Marc Dorcel, the company set out to radically alter the production values of adult film. During the late 1970s and early 1980s, the industry was dominated by low-budget, gritty productions designed for adult theaters. Dorcel introduced a philosophy that would come to define the brand: high-end production design, complex narratives, and an emphasis on aesthetics over raw explicit content.
